Privacy-Preserving Technologies in Data
Abstract
Federated learning (FL) offers a promising approach to training machine learning models across decentralized devices while preserving data privacy. However, FL systems are vulnerable to Byzantine faults, where malicious participants introduce corrupted model updates, compromising the integrity of the global model. This paper proposes a novel framework for distributed federated learning with Byzantine fault tolerance, leveraging the power of homomorphic encryption. The system encrypts model updates using homomorphic encryption, allowing the central server to perform aggregation computations directly on the encrypted data. This approach eliminates the need for decryption, thereby safeguarding client data and providing robust protection against Byzantine attacks. The core claim of this work is that the combination of FL with homomorphic encryption provides a fundamentally secure and resilient solution for distributed model training. We detail the system architecture, the encryption and aggregation protocols, and analyze the security and performance implications. The proposed method significantly enhances the robustness of FL against malicious participants, offering a practical solution for privacy-sensitive applications.
